1973. In a close-knit community on Ireland’s west coast, a baby is found
abandoned on the beach. Named Brendan Bonnar by Ambrose, the fisherman who
adopts him, Brendan will become a source of fascination and hope for a town
caught in the storm of a rapidly changing world.
Ambrose, a man more comfortable at sea than on land, brings Brendan into his
home out of love. But it’s a decision that will fracture his family and force
him to try to understand himself and those he cares for.
Bookended by the arrival and departure of a single mesmerizing boy, Garrett
Carr's The Boy From the Sea is an exploration of the ties that make us and bind
us, as a family and community move irresistibly towards the future.
